My field of specialization is International Relations. In my teaching I
concetrate in Africa in World Affairs, particularly, conflict resolution
in Africa; Intenational law and Africa :selected issues; Foreign policy of
African States; Multinational Corporations and Development in Africa. As
for regional studies, I emphasize Lusophone Africa, particularly
Mozambique.
